Contexte et objectifs
- Développer la V2 d’un système existant de gestion d’événements et de contrôle d’accès afin d’améliorer performance, ergonomie et stabilité.
- Moderniser l’architecture et l’interface tout en conservant les fonctionnalités essentielles de la plateforme actuelle (SoluEvents).
Fonctionnalités à implémenter / améliorer
- Optimisation du module billetterie pour des performances et une scalabilité accrues.
- Refonte du tableau de bord, gestion plus précise des zones d’accès et synchronisation plus rapide avec les dispositifs (scanners, tourniquets).
- Meilleure organisation de la base de données et intégration des améliorations demandées par les organisateurs.
Tâches techniques et responsabilités
- Concevoir et implémenter des composants front-end en Angular pour la nouvelle interface utilisateur.
- Développer et optimiser les services back-end en Node.js et améliorer les requêtes/structures MySQL pour la performance.
- Assurer la synchronisation temps réel avec les dispositifs (scanners, tourniquets) et la stabilité des échanges.
Contraintes du projet et livrables
- Projet individuel (1 personne) sur une durée de 4 mois; niveau d’études requis : BAC +3.
- Livrables attendus : code source de la V2, documentation technique (architecture, API), scripts de migration/optimisation de la base de données, rapport final et démonstration fonctionnelle.
Outils et stack technique
- Front-end : ANGULAR
- Back-end : NODE JS
- Base de données : MYSQL
- Mise au point et tests de performance, corrections d’ergonomie et améliorations de la stabilité.
Candidature
- Envoyez votre candidature (CV + lettre de motivation + exemples de projets) à :
stage@solumove.net
- Précisez dans l'objet de votre email que la candidature concerne ce PFE et détaillez votre expérience avec Angular, Node.js et MySQL.